At present, the mine engineering background is complex, frequent accidents, coal production not only by the threat of natural disasters, but also by their quality of coal miners. In a complex mine environment, mine workers can not carry out on-site training can keep abreast of the dynamic information of mine, which also resulted in coal mine accidents have occurred. Currently, many foreign countries have a mature mine virtual reality system, but the software is not only more expensive in price and scope of use has some limitations, other, high training and maintenance costs for the average enterprise is unable to bear. Therefore, developing a set of easy to use, inexpensive, easy to learn for the virtual enterprise in China's coal mine system is necessary, the issue is raised on this basis.In this paper, fusion of digital image processing, computer graphics, multimedia technology, sensor technology, and other information technology branch of virtual reality technology, development and design of an advanced virtual mine system. The system is designed to VC++as the platform, using advanced modeling tools MultiGen Creator, advanced visual simulation tool Vega, on the mine environment? work equipment to simulate the realistic simulation of the mine complex operating environment, a true representation of the production process, efficient production for the mine, workers safety education, mine accidents, provides reliable protection treatment.The system has been able to turn in Zhongping Mine Group, Minmetals was partially achieved, mainly used in mine safety training and on-site production guidance, the system of the coal miners in improving the quality of production and play a better role in promoting.Virtual reality technology in coal mine engineering will become more widely used, this virtual reality technology future distribution of mineral resources to further Yanjiu forecast mine design optimization, disaster prevention and so on.
